Output ec08ef2754ea316d263206442866675f5eb6e22d4fe18a57dc422e680af44d3b:42

value
12620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a37d9400ad0bcc5622f0bdb68cbfe6ce269c517 OP_EQUALVERIFY OP_CHECKSIG
address
1w2fMGLGe3PaEnHipKwDN7s5go4VoPFCR
transaction
ec08ef2754ea316d263206442866675f5eb6e22d4fe18a57dc422e680af44d3b
spent
true